文件名称:程序员考试刷题-oca-preparation:准备OCA认证的一些示例和文件
文件大小:47KB
文件格式:ZIP
更新时间:2024-07-27 06:51:40
系统开源
程序员考试刷题oca-准备 为 OCA 认证准备的一些示例和文件。 第1章 有效标识符 标识符可以包含字母、数字、$ 或 _。 标识符不能以数字开头。 数字文字可能在两个数字之间包含下划线,并以 1-9、0、0x、0X、0b、0B 开头。 类中元素的顺序 元素 例子 必需的 它去哪里? 包装声明 包 abc; 不 文件中的第一行 导入语句 导入 java.util.*; 不 打包后立即 类声明 公开课 C 是的 导入后立即 字段声明 整数值; 不 班级内的任何地方 方法声明 空方法() 不 班级内的任何地方 想想首字母缩略词 PIC(图片):Package、import 和 class。 完成() 任何类都可以实现 finalize 方法来完成清理工作 垃圾收集器收集对象时调用的方法 方法被调用 0 次或 1 次 调用 System.gc() 表明 Java 可能希望运行垃圾收集器 Java 可以随意忽略请求 Java 的好处 面向对象Java 是一种面向对象的语言。 它允许在类内进行函数式编程,但面向对象仍然是代码的主要组织方式。 封装Java 支持访问修饰符以保护数据免遭意外访问和
【文件预览】:
oca-preparation-master
----.gitignore(8B)
----chapter3()
--------IncompatibleTypes.java(562B)
--------review-questions.md(2KB)
--------EqualsOperator.java(691B)
--------ArrayBinarySearch.java(465B)
--------Strings.java(716B)
--------DatesAndTime.java(4KB)
--------PrimitiveTypesAndWrapperClasses.java(2KB)
--------StringBuilders.java(735B)
--------Arrays.java(2KB)
----playground()
--------TestClass.java(2KB)
----chapter1()
--------notes.txt(980B)
--------review-questions.md(443B)
--------AttributeTest.java(181B)
--------ValidIdentifiers.java(573B)
--------Zoo.java(215B)
--------compile-with-packages()
--------AccessingParameters.java(255B)
--------multiple-classes-per-file()
----chapter5()
--------defining-constructors()
--------abstract-classes()
--------review-questions.md(971B)
--------diamond-problem()
--------overriding-a-method()
--------class-access-modifiers()
--------implementing-interfaces()
--------casting-objects()
--------default-methods-in-interfaces()
--------review-questions-code()
----README.md(24KB)
----chapter6()
--------throwing-a-second-exception()
--------review-questions.md(1KB)
--------implementing-interfaces-with-exceptions()
--------return-in-catch-block()
--------unreachable-code()
--------printing-an-exception()
----chapter2()
--------LabelsOnIf.java(561B)
--------review-questions.md(530B)
--------ForLoops.java(435B)
--------Operands.java(734B)
--------Operators.java(2KB)
--------CompoundOperator.java(280B)
--------Switch.java(954B)
--------PostfixIncrement.java(430B)
--------IfElseIf.java(309B)
--------Labels.java(437B)
--------NumericPromotion.java(358B)
--------OverflowUnderflow.java(1000B)
----chapter4()
--------review-questions.md(957B)
--------creating-constructors()
--------overloading-constructors()
--------final-fields()
--------InheritanceAndCasts.java(532B)
--------order-of-initialization()
--------review-question-10()